Opting for the Perfect Gems

When choosing gems for your jewellery assortment, reflect on your individual style and the message you wish to convey. Various gems come with distinct hues, significances, and vibrations. For a more vibrant and cheerful look, you might opt for vividly hued stones like turquoise or yellow topaz, while darker hues like jade or blue corundum offer an elegance that is ideal for special occasions. Understanding the features of each gem will assist you develop a group that resonates with your individuality.
Another crucial consideration in picking gemstones is their toughness and wearability. Some stones, like diamonds and the ruby, are more resilient and can withstand regular use, making them suitable for pieces you intend to don frequently. Others, like the opal or the turquoise, may require extra care to sustain their beauty. Think about how regularly you will don the jewellery and select stones that suit your routine without compromising on appearance.

Techniques for Stacking
Stacking jewelry jewelry efficiently needs a sharp sense for balance and style. A common technique is to mix different sizes of chains to create a cascading effect. Start with a choker piece, then add a intermediate necklace, and conclude with a lengthier pendant. This variety in size allows each stone to shine while also blending with the overall look. Featuring various elements, such as a polished gemstone coupled with one that has a complex design, can also add depth to your layered ensemble.
When it comes to layering band rings, consider mixing various sizes and styles on various fingers. For example, a bold gemstone ring can be paired with delicate bands featuring smaller stones or plain metals. This differentiation not only showcases the appeal of the standout piece but also fosters a playful feel. It's essential to maintain a unified color palette, ensuring that the gemstones enhance each other rather than conflict, boosting the overall style.
Bracelet stacking is another exciting way to showcase your gemstone ornaments. Mix different designs, from cuffs to stringed pieces, but maintain a coherent color palette or thematic concept. Layering gemstones with other materials, such as fabric or metal, adds a modern twist. Pay care to the fit as well; creating a little space between bracelets allows for mobility and highlights each piece's distinct attributes, creating a visually appealing arrangement.
Maintaining Multi-Layered Accessories
Looking After multi-layered gemstone jewelry is important to preserve its beauty and longevity. When wearing various items, it's crucial to evaluate how they interact with each other. Steer clear of layering pieces that may snag or scratch one another, as this can result in damage over time. To avoid entanglement, consider choosing chains with varying lengths and styles, which allows each piece to shine while enhancing the total appearance.
Maintaining the cleanliness of your layered pieces consistently is crucial. Use a mild soap and warm solution for cleaning gemstone jewelry, and stay away from harsh chemicals that can damage the gems or metal settings. A soft, lint-free towel can be used to polish the stones and metal pieces after they have been cleaned. Keep your jewelry in a dry environment, ideally in a plush pouch or individual compartments to prevent damage and tangling when not in use.
Ultimately, be mindful of the conditions in which you wear your stacked pieces. It is recommended to remove your pieces before engaging in tasks that may expose it to excessive moisture, such as taking a dip or showering. Additionally, avoid wearing it while doing chores or exercising, as these can cause wear and tear. By follow these simple precautions, you can make sure that your gemstone jewelry remains looking gorgeous and stylish for years to come.
